Paperback. Zustand: New. Print on Demand. This book is an in-depth analysis of the Roman Martyrology, a catalogue of saints and martyrs recognized by the Catholic Church. The author meticulously examines the historical development of the Martyrology, tracing its origins and evolution over centuries. Through a rigorous examination of primary sources, including papal decrees, liturgical texts, and historical accounts, the author sheds light on the criteria and processes involved in the inclusion and removal of saints from the Martyrology. Moreover, the book delves into the complex relationship between the Martyrology and the evolving understanding of sainthood in the Catholic tradition, exploring the theological, historical, and cultural factors that have shaped its contents. By providing a comprehensive and nuanced study of the Martyrology, this book offers valuable insights into the history of Christian devotion, the development of liturgical practices, and the role of the Catholic Church in the veneration of saints.
